Performance in Different Fabrics and Surfaces
When it comes to fabric, the 1 Teacher design performs well on a variety of textures. It stitches cleanly on smooth fabrics like cotton and polyester, making it ideal for t-shirts and tote bags. However, use caution with textured or stretchy fabrics, as the design's clean lines might get lost in the texture. For curved surfaces like caps, the design's simplicity helps, but it's still advisable to test it on a scrap piece first to ensure it doesn't distort.
Stitch Density and Detail Considerations
The 1 Teacher design has a balanced stitch density, which is crucial for maintaining the integrity of the design and the fabric. It uses a combination of satin stitch and fill stitch, which adds a nice texture and depth. When using this design on thin or delicate fabrics, consider reducing the stitch density slightly to prevent the fabric from puckering or tearing. Always use a proper stabilizer to ensure the best results.

Practical Designer Notes for 1 Teacher
- Test on Scrap Fabric: Always test the design on a scrap piece of fabric to check for any issues before embroidering on the final product.
- Thread Color Contrast: Choose thread colors that contrast well with the fabric to ensure the design stands out. For example, a dark thread on a light fabric or vice versa.
- Review Stitch Density: Adjust the stitch density if needed, especially for thin or delicate fabrics, to prevent puckering and tearing.
- Check Hoop Size: Ensure the design fits within the hoop size you are using. If necessary, resize the design to fit the available space.
- Inspect Small Details: Carefully inspect the design for any small details that might need special attention, such as tiny lettering or decorative accents.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: Use the appropriate stabilizer for the fabric type to ensure the design stitches out smoothly and cleanly.
- Confirm Licensing: Before selling finished items or digital products, confirm the licensing terms to ensure you have the right to use the design commercially.
